Verdict
Present Man won one of these at Chepstow, with Theatre Guide well behind, before finishing sixth in the Badger Beers at Wincanton. He clearly retains plenty of ability but is looking a couple of pounds too high at present. Vintage Clouds was taken to task by the handicapper after winning last season’s Peter Marsh but is starting to slip down the ratings again and could reverse Aintree running with Theatre Guide. Strong Pursuit has had his problems but could figure if fully wound up but Nicky Henderson holds a strong hand. VALTOR ran better than the final result suggests in a Grade 3 at Ascot on his reappearance so is preferred to Gold Present, who refused to race at Sandown 10 days ago and hasn’t won in almost three years.
